
Force Bounces Back, Handles Legends 110-92
Published on March 4, 2022 under NBA G League (G League)
Sioux Falls Skyforce News Release
Sioux Falls, SD - The Sioux Falls Skyforce responded with a 110-92 victory over the Texas Legends on Friday night in the second of a back-to-back.
Sioux Falls (10-13) moves to 3-1 this season on the backend and has won the last three games in the finale of a back-to-back. They also move to 8-2 when out rebounding the opponent.
Micah Potter (26 points on 12-18 FGA and seven rebounds) led the Force in scoring in consecutive nights. He has also secured 10-plus field goal makes in both outings, as well.
The Skyforce jumped out to a 36-13 lead after the first quarter, while shooting 60.9 percent (14-23 FGA) and 85.7 percent from deep (6-7 3PA). Mychal Mulder (15 points on 4-9 3PA) posted 11 points in the quarter alone on 3-3 3PA in his first start back with the team.
Potter posted nine points on 4-7 FGA and five rebounds in the second quarter alone to give Sioux Falls a 62-36 lead at intermission. The lead marked the biggest advantage at halftime this season.
The Legends outscored the Skyforce 56-48 in the second half, behind a combined 20 points from Feron Hunt (16 points on 6-12 FGA) and Chris Walker (13 points).
Sam Thompson posted a season-high 19 points on 8-13 FGA and seven rebounds. Mario Chalmers posted his first double-double with the Skyforce, with 14 points on 4-8 3PA and a G League career-high 13 assists. Chandler Hutchison added 12 points, nine rebounds and a G League career-high eight assists.
Justin Jackson led all scorers for Texas with 17 points, while grabbing eight rebounds.
The Skyforce travel to face the Iowa Wolves on Sunday, with tip-off slated for 3:00 PM CST at Wells Fargo Arena. The Legends continue the road, facing the Birmingham Squadron at 7:00 PM CST.
